Contrasting Opinions on False Speech and the Stolen Valor Act
The majority opinion regarding false speech often emphasizes the importance of protecting free speech even when that speech may be harmful or misleading. It prioritizes the First Amendment rights and warns against the dangers of restricting speech, which could lead to broader implications for freedom of expression. In contrast, the dissenting opinion typically argues that certain types of false speech, especially those that assert fraudulent claims like those addressed by the Stolen Valor Act, should not be protected as they undermine the integrity of essential societal values such as honor and truthfulness.
Thus, the majority might view restrictions on speech as a slippery slope towards government overreach, while the dissenting view may support accountability for deceptive acts that have tangible consequences.
